I am curious to know if a back-to-basics Stargate series would work at this point in the franchise's history. Though the show evolved in really cool ways over the years (in fact, I submit it's one of the best examples of cohesive world building and mythology creating ever on TV), I sometimes get a little nostalgic for the early format of the show, which to my eyes was modeled after Star Trek: TNG or TOS; each week they'd pick a new planet to visit and explore, run into unique problems, and overcome their character flaws and differences in order to succeed. I really liked that aspect of it, and the discovery of different civilizations. It's definitely something they tried to keep throughout the run even as the mythology episodes took over. SGA had a little of this as well, but from the start that series was steeped in mythos episodes. And of course SGU was very much a setting-based, "big idea" series that and IMO didn't get the viewers because it was something just too different from what came before - I am certain they had a mandate from SyFy to do a riff on BSG, and the result was not what many fans expected from a Stargate series.
So specifically, here's my question - let's say we lived in a world where Brad Wright was given the mandate to restart the TV franchise. Would a show about a new team of explorers going planet to planet be enough to carry the show, or would it fall short of what we as fans want when it comes to season (or series) long story arcs? Like maybe they discover a second network of stargates within our galaxy that went to planets not on the current system (therefor keeping threats "local" to our galaxy, but still getting away from past threats - call it SG-2 ). Maybe that specific idea is not right... but I hope you get what I'm asking.
